Matlock 4 miles; Bakewell 13 miles. Bonsall is a little village situated at the heart of the Derbyshire Dales, on the outskirts of the Peak District National Park, just 4 miles from Matlock. It was named in the Domesday Book, with history dating back to Roman times. This previous lead mining and textile producing village is famous for its 19 alleged UFO sightings, with the Barley Mow pub offering UFO walks, some of which have actually been filmed by the BBC!
